## Formula sandbox tuning

User-supplied formulas in Gridmoor execute inside a restricted interpreter with hard ceilings on time, memory, and call depth. Reviewers should confirm any change to these ceilings is justified in the PR description, since raising them widens the abuse surface. Defaults were chosen from production traces. The current limits are as follows.

limits module of tafog-fawip:
WEIGHTS = {
    "julix": 57,
    "lamys": 992,
    "kasvan": 209,
    "quenok": 750,
    "alddor": 259,
    "oliath": 1009,
    "wenix": 815,
}

### Date localization

Quick heads-up before the Larkspur release: the new DateShape layer picks formats per locale, but we cache compiled patterns aggressively because formatting shows up hot in profiles. The cache sizes and fallback timeouts matter — too small and we thrash on mixed-locale dashboards, too big and memory creeps on low-end clients. We landed on values after testing against the Bremholt traffic replay. The constants shipping in this release are these.

constants for tageg-kagag:
QUOTAS = {
    "kelax": 495,
    "istath": 366,
    "tammir": 108,
    "novdor": 730,
    "casax": 816,
    "quenael": 874,
    "pelius": 403,
}

## Runbook: Extracting the User Module from Corvana Core

New team members: the user module split proceeds in phases. First, route all profile reads through the Lanthorn adapter while writes stay in the monolith. Verify dual-write parity for 48 hours before flipping reads. Every cutover step must be logged against the migration build identified immediately below.

pipeline stamp: htk4_ae36

Quick snapshot-testing primer for releases: every UI component in Fernwick renders into a golden snapshot, and the release pipeline diffs these against main before anything ships. If a diff shows up, don't just re-bless it — ping the owning squad first, since layout drift has bitten us twice. Once snapshots are green, the release bundle gets signed automatically by the pipeline. For manual re-signing in an emergency, use the key shown below.

deploy key for kajof-fajop: bky6_gDHw9Q